Easy to maneuver

A pushchair is a type of baby-conveying vehicle that usually has four wheels and is designed for older children and toddlers. It can be front or www.pushchairsandprams.Uk rear-facing and can be folded and collapsible for easy transportation in the back of vehicles or on public transportation. A pushchair may also be called a stroller.

There are many types of pushchairs on the market. Some have three wheels and are more manoeuvrable while others have four and are more stable. Some models have swivel wheels that make it easier to turn in tight areas like aisles of shopping. Others have all-terrain wheels that can withstand bumps and holes in the road.

You can read online reviews about how it is to control and steer a pushchair if you are looking for one that is easy to maneuver. Be aware of comments on how the pushchair can handle and navigate roads and curbs, as this is one of the most important features of a quality pushchair.

You should also consider the amount of weight that the pushchair is carrying. Some pushchairs are quite heavy. You may prefer a model that is lighter, to make it easier to carry up stairs or to lift up to the first-floor of your home.

A pushchair must be comfortable for parents and children. Choose models that have soft, cushioned straps and upholstery for the seat to make it a more enjoyable ride for your little one. The pushchair should also have a large storage basket. Some have additional features, such as a parasol and rain cover. Consider a convertible pushchair that will grow with your baby and offers various seating configurations.

Comfortable

A comfortable pushchair will allow you to spend more time with your child. Find models with a soft, padded seat liner and reclining options which can keep your child comfortable. The best pushchairs come with a footmuff and cup holder, as well as a rain cover. These features increase their comfort. Some models have a built-in baby hood, which is handy for those unpredictable British weather conditions.

A practical pushchair should also include a large basket that can be used to transport everything you require every day, like nappies and snacks. Be sure that the basket can be accessed when the seat of the pushchair reclines and that it is large enough to accommodate your usual purchases. You should also look at the brakes A single pedal brake that locks both rear wheels and will ensure that the pushchair is secure even when stationary.

A pram is a pushchair with a lie-flat seat which is suitable for babies from birth. A pushchair features an adjustable seat that can be adjusted to various reclining positions - from fully flat to sitting up straight - so it is suitable for toddlers and older children.

Many pushchairs can be used right from birth if they have a carrycot attachment or a compatible car seat, which can be affixed to the frame to create an entire travel system. Some models come with an extra seat that can be connected to the frame, allowing you to convert your pushchair into a tandem or twin pushchair for siblings of similar age. Our testers love this feature, which allows you to adapt your pushchair as your family grows. It is worthwhile to check the product's description to find out what accessories are included, since they can make a huge difference to how easy it is to use.

Easy to clean

One of the most important characteristics of a pushchair is its ability to be cleaned easily. Spillages, food residues and mould are all common in a pushchair. It is crucial to clean it frequently. It is recommended to give it a quick clean-up after every use, and a full wash at least once a week.

Before you begin cleaning your pushchair it's important to vacuum off any loose dirt, crumbs and debris. Use a handheld vacuum with a nozzle that can be flexed, or a regular household vacuum. Make sure to get into all the corners and crevices.

After you've done this, you can begin cleaning the fabric parts of your My Babiie MB51 Stroller - Lightweight Travel Buggy. The instructions of the manufacturer may differ however, in general it is safe to use a mild baby-safe soap and warm water. You can make use of an old toothbrush to get rid of dirt and grime from difficult-to-reach areas or creases.

It's also a good idea to clean the wheel and chassis frame frequently. You can use a hose for removing any mud or sand that is wet. You should also wash the wheels regularly using an broomstick, and warm soapy water.

It's a good idea use disinfecting wipes on the harder parts of your pushchair such as the frames, handles and other hard plastic components. Follow the directions on the packaging of the product to ensure an effective cleaning.
